苹果旧版本软件下载教程与历史版本兼容性解决方案
一、需求背景与技术挑战
随着苹果生态的持续迭代,部分用户因设备性能限制、功能适配需求或界面偏好,需回退至旧版本应用。由于App Store仅提供最新版本下载,且iOS系统限制第三方安装包直接部署,苹果旧版本软件下载教程与历史版本兼容性解决方案成为技术领域的重要课题。
主要挑战包括:
1. 官方渠道限制:App Store默认隐藏历史版本,仅允许通过购买记录恢复有限版本;
2. 系统签名验证:iOS强制验证应用签名,低版本安装包可能因证书过期导致安装失败;
3. 设备兼容性冲突:旧版本应用可能无法适配高版本iOS系统或新型硬件架构。
二、核心方法与工具选型
1. iTunes抓包降级方案(推荐指数:★★★★☆)
用途:通过拦截iTunes下载请求,替换版本ID实现旧版应用获取,适用于iOS 7及以上系统。
配置要求:
实施步骤:
1. 环境搭建:
2. 请求拦截:
3. 版本替换:
2. 第三方工具自动化方案(推荐指数:★★★☆☆)
用途:简化抓包流程,一键获取历史版本,适合非技术用户。
配置要求:
操作流程:
1. 工具配置:
2. 下载管理:
3. 官方兼容性恢复方案(推荐指数:★★☆☆☆)
用途:直接通过App Store获取系统适配版本,无需越狱或电脑辅助。
适用场景:
实施步骤:
1. 进入「设置」→「媒体与购买项目」→「查看购买记录」;
2. 找到目标应用并点击下载,系统自动推送兼容性版本提示;
3. 确认后下载安装,若失败需通过其他设备触发版本同步。
三、兼容性优化与问题排查
1. 签名验证绕过技术
问题现象:安装时提示“无法验证完整性”。
解决方案:
2. 系统版本冲突处理
适配策略:
降级步骤:
1. 备份数据后进入DFU模式;
2. 下载对应IPSW固件,通过iTunes/Finder强制刷机;
3. 禁用自动更新并安装旧版应用。
3. 功能异常调试方案
典型故障:
应对措施:
四、安全规范与法律风险提示
在实施苹果旧版本软件下载教程与历史版本兼容性解决方案时需注意:
1. 数据安全:
2. 法律边界:
3. 版本选择建议:
五、未来趋势与技术展望
随着iOS 18引入侧载功能与欧盟DMA法案的落地,苹果旧版本软件下载教程与历史版本兼容性解决方案将呈现新特征:
1. 官方侧载通道:通过AltStore等平台合法安装历史版本;
2. 区块链存证:利用去中心化网络存储经过验证的旧版IPA;
3. AI兼容预测:基于设备参数自动推荐最优版本。
> 本文方法论整合自Charles抓包实践、Fiddler降级方案、第三方工具评测及苹果官方技术文档,具体工具下载与操作细节可访问原始获取。